A sample of lithium sulfate, (Li2SO4), has 2.94 x 1023 atoms
of lithium. How many moles of lithium sulfate is the sample?

Respuesta :

HuyMaiSweetie
HuyMaiSweetie HuyMaiSweetie
  • 27-07-2021

Answer:

0.245 moles

Explanation:

moles of lithium = 2*moles of Li2SO4

so moles of LI2SO4=2.94*10^23/(2*6*10^23)=0.245
